1、平台微服务架构

微服务架构是一种架构模式,它提倡将单一应用程序划分成一组小的服务,服务之间胡亮协调、互相配合,为用户提供最终价值。在微服务架构中,服务与服务之间通信时,通常是通过轻量级的通信机制,实现彼此间的互通互联、互相协作。所谓轻量级通信机制,通常是指与语言无关、与平台无关的这类协议。通过轻量级通信机制,使服务与服务之间的协作变得简单、标准化。

主流微服务架构技术方案:

微服务核心问题是分工、协作和治理。微服务分工即如何拆分微服务,每个服务如何独立运行,微服务协作是指服务间如何通讯,这两个问题是低代码开发平台要解决的,云程低代码平台(http://www.yunchengxc.com)完全遵照云原生十二要素法,基于云程平台开发的应用自然满足微服务架构。微服务治理和容器云有独立开源或商业产品,业界称其为gPaaS或云底座,云程平台产品定位aPaaS(应用程序平台即服务Application PaaS),不做gPaaS(General PaaS),但可与主流的gPaaS平台进行集成融合,提供技术解决方案,包括:开源Spring Cloud、kubernetes(简称k8s)等、商业产品华为云、阿里云、腾讯云等。

2、微服务主要技术栈

1、服务注册发现: Nacos

2、服务配置中心: Nacos

3、服务网关:Spring Cloud Gateway

4、熔断限流: Sentinel

5、服务监控: Spring Boot Admin

6、分布式数据库:RDS

7、分布式缓存:Redis

8、分布式文件: Minio

9、分布式事务: Seata

10、链路跟踪:SkyWarking

11、分布式日志:ELK(Elasticsearch , Logstash, Kibana)

12、容器云:kubernetes、Rancher

13、CI/CD持续集成/部署:Jenkins

14、代码仓库:GitLab

15、镜像仓库:Harbor

3、微服务治理主要功能

服务注册中心:

服务配置中心:

服务监控中心:

服务熔断限流:

Spring Cloud微服务技术架构方案相关推荐

  1. Spring Cloud 微服务技术栈

    Spring Cloud 简介 主要内容 微服务简介 SpringCloud 简介 SpringCloud 框架结构 SpringCloud 和 Dubbo 的对比 SpringCloud 版本号说明 ...

  2. Spring Cloud微服务系统架构的一些简单介绍和使用

    Spring Cloud 目录 特征 云原生应用程序 Spring Cloud上下文:应用程序上下文服务 引导应用程序上下文 应用程序上下文层次结构 改变Bootstrap的位置Properties ...

  3. (二)spring cloud微服务分布式云架构 - 整合企业架构的技术点

    spring cloud本身提供的组件就很多,但我们需要按照企业的业务模式来定制企业所需要的通用架构,那我们现在需要考虑使用哪些技术呢? 下面我针对于spring cloud微服务分布式云架构做了以下 ...

  4. spring cloud微服务分布式云架构 - 整合企业架构的技术点

    spring cloud本身提供的组件就很多,但我们需要按照企业的业务模式来定制企业所需要的通用架构,那我们现在需要考虑使用哪些技术呢? 下面我针对于spring cloud微服务分布式云架构做了以下 ...

  5. (二)spring cloud微服务分布式云架构-整合企业架构的技术点

    spring cloud本身提供的组件就很多,但我们需要按照企业的业务模式来定制企业所需要的通用架构,那我们现在需要考虑使用哪些技术呢?Spring Cloud大型企业分布式微服务云架构源码请加一七九 ...

  6. spring cloud微服务分布式云架构 - 整合企业架构的技术点(二)

    点击上面 免费订阅本账号! 本文作者:it菲菲 原文:https://yq.aliyun.com/articles/672231 点击阅读全文前往 spring cloud本身提供的组件就很多,但我们 ...

  7. spring cloud微服务分布式云架构 - Spring Cloud简介

    Spring Cloud是一系列框架的有序集合.利用Spring Boot的开发模式简化了分布式系统基础设施的开发,如服务发现.注册.配置中心.消息总线.负载均衡.断路器.数据监控等(这里只简单的列了 ...

  8. spring cloud微服务分布式云架构 - Spring Cloud简介(一)

    点击上面 免费订阅本账号! 本文作者:it菲菲 原文:https://yq.aliyun.com/articles/672239? 点击阅读全文前往 Spring Cloud是一系列框架的有序集合.利 ...

  9. spring cloud微服务分布式云架构 - common-service 项目构建过程

    欢迎大家和我一起学习spring cloud构建微服务云架构,我这边会将近期研发的spring cloud微服务云架构的搭建过程和精髓记录下来,帮助更多有兴趣研发spring cloud框架的朋友,大 ...

最新文章

  1. 简单XML文件C#操作方法
  2. 技术开发中一些名词解释
  3. html table没有align,HTML
  4. fedora7 常用软件安装
  5. 在屏幕上将1234逐位打印出来1,2,3,4
  6. SpringCloud Sentinel 结合OpenFeign的使用介绍
  7. 存数据返回他的序列号id_雪花般的分布式唯一ID雪花算法
  8. EF里查看/修改实体的当前值、原始值和数据库值
  9. 『C#基础』C#调用存储过程
  10. 窃取5亿雅虎用户信息的黑客 被判处5年有期徒刑
  11. 传华为公司又一名技术部员工乔向英猝死
  12. 《财富的未来》——佐藤航阳读书笔记
  13. 三维分子图的球面信息传递
  14. MySQL讲义第49讲——select 查询之查询练习(七):使用多种方法添加排名
  15. 书单|开工第一周,有哪些助你弯道超车的好书?
  16. w10电脑c盘满了怎么清理_w10电脑自动更新安装完c盘满了怎么清理
  17. 每日刷题记录 (六)
  18. sockaddr,sockaddr_in,sockaddr_un结构体详细讲解
  19. 用docker搭建discuz论坛
  20. excel表格怎么固定表头?

热门文章

  1. C++实现MD5摘要算法加盐salt值
  2. Python时间和日历讲解总结
  3. 《智能控制技术》学习笔记-2.1,模糊集合论基础、模糊逻辑、模糊逻辑推理和合成
  4. 学习,自律,锻炼意味着更高的自由
  5. 黑苹果 惠普笔记本电池补丁_惠普ProDesk 400 G3 DM黑苹果成功
  6. Matlab的imfilter函数用法
  7. C++ QT QLocalSocket/QLocalServer基操
  8. 标准15针 VGA 显示接口定义及焊接方法
  9. 招聘帖-北森大连分公司招.net后端/前端/测试负责人啦!!!
  10. 期刊投稿状态_你知道SCI论文审稿的12种状态吗?